Town will clean up rest of storm mess By John J. Hopkins Times A potential agreement between Cheektowaga and Erie County to clear debris alongside county roads from last October's freak snowstorm stalled at county hall last week when the proposal was sent to committee for discussion, but the town intends to carry out the plan without the county's help. Trustees walk out of meeting following ethnic slur allegation Two Village of Sloan board members walked out of Tuesday's meeting after one was accused by a fellow trustee of making an ethnic slur during an argument between the two on April 12 outside the village hall. More ...
